The best neighborhoods in Marostica to stay in:
The most popular areas to stay in Marostica are the historic center and the surrounding countryside. The historic center offers easy access to the town's attractions, charming cafes, and restaurants, while the countryside provides a peaceful retreat with stunning views of the surrounding landscape. Both areas offer a unique experience of Marostica's culture and beauty.
